It would be useful to have a version of Vim that is compiled with Python 3 support. This will allow for some additional plugins to be used.
If this change is possible it may be worthwhile to follow the way some Linux distros handle it and provide multiple packages with different features compiled into Vim to avoid changing the existing package. Ubuntu / Debian provide vim-tiny, vim, and vim-nox.
